Ultra-compact Minox 35GT with folding Minotar f/2.8, one of the smallest full-frame 35mm cameras ever produced.
The Minox 35GT is a variant of the ultra-compact Minox 35 series from 1981, featuring the Color-Minotar 35mm f/2.8 lens in the iconic clamshell folding body. The GT version adds a modified metering system or shutter specification over the basic GL, refining the exposure automation.
The Color-Minotar 35mm f/2.8 lens delivers sharp images belying the camera's incredibly tiny dimensions. The folding design collapses the camera to a pocket-flat profile barely larger than a credit card, making it one of the most genuinely portable 35mm cameras ever produced.
Build quality is precision Minox with a metal body and carefully engineered folding mechanism. The mechanical precision of the folding front cover, lens deployment, and shutter mechanism demonstrates Minox's heritage in miniature precision instruments.
The Minox 35GT holds moderate collector value on the used market as part of the celebrated 35 series. The ultra-compact design, quality Minotar optics, and Minox precision engineering create a camera that provides genuine 35mm capability in the smallest possible package.
